On Monday, the S&P 500 ended the day lower, wiping out earlier gains that had brought the index to its highest level in nine months. The S&P 500 lost 0.2%, closing at 4,273.79, while the Nasdaq Composite dipped 0.09% to 13,229.43, and the Dow Jones Industrial Average dropped 0.59% to 33,562.86. Stocks declined on Wednesday as investors closely watched the federal debt ceiling debate in Washington. The Dow Jones Industrial Average dropped 0.41%, the S&P 500 dipped 0.61%, and the Nasdaq Composite slipped 0.63%.
